How to Reach Requeil in France

Requeil is a charming commune located in the Sarthe department of Pays de la Loire region in northwestern France. If you are planning a visit to this picturesque village, here are a few ways to reach Requeil:

By Air:

The nearest major international airport to Requeil is the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port (CDG). From there, you can either rent a car or take a train to reach Requeil. The journey by car takes approximately 2.5 to 3 hours, depending on traffic conditions.

By Train:

If you prefer traveling by train, the TGV (high-speed train) offers convenient connections from major cities in France to Le Mans, which is the closest city with a train station to Requeil. From Le Mans, you can either rent a car or take a taxi to Requeil, which is about a 30-minute drive away.

By Car:

If you are already in France or prefer a road trip, reaching Requeil by car is a great option. The village is easily accessible via the A11 motorway. Simply follow the signs towards Le Mans and then take the D323 road towards Requeil. The journey offers beautiful countryside views and takes approximately 2 hours from Paris.

By Public Transportation:

Requeil is a small village with limited public transportation options. However, you can take a regional bus from Le Mans to reach nearby towns, such as La Flèche or Château-du-Loir, and then hire a taxi or arrange for a local shuttle service to take you to Requeil.

Getting to know Requeil

Requeil is a charming commune located in the Sarthe department in the Pays de la Loire region of northwestern France. Situated in the heart of the Loir Valley, Requeil is surrounded by picturesque countryside, lush vineyards, and rolling hills, making it a delightful destination for nature lovers and outdoor enthusiasts.

The village of Requeil itself is small but rich in history and character. Its quaint streets are lined with traditional stone houses, many of which date back several centuries. The Romanesque-style Church of Saint-Martin, with its intricate architectural details, stands as a testament to the village's medieval past.

One of the highlights of Requeil is its proximity to the Loir River, which flows gently through the countryside, offering opportunities for boating, fishing, and leisurely walks along its banks. The river also provides a stunning backdrop for picnics and outdoor activities, allowing visitors to immerse themselves in the natural beauty of the region.

Furthermore, Requeil is ideally located for exploring the wider region. The nearby town of La Flèche, known for its impressive château and beautiful gardens, is just a short drive away. Visitors can also venture to the renowned Le Mans, famous for its annual 24-hour car race and its well-preserved medieval old town.
